We have measured levels of contaminants (products of cell lysis and other substances) in blood salvaged from patients undergoing primary cemented total hip replacement. Washing of this blood removed an average of 91.4% of the free haemoglobin mass, reduced white cell lysozyme concentrations by 86% and almost totally eliminated fats and particulate matter. Osmotic fragility was significantly improved by washing although not to control levels.
